Jan. 22: County Council Public Hearing and More
The Montgomery County Council at 1:30 p.m. on Tuesday, Jan. 22, will hold a public hearing on Bill 33-12 that would ban smoking on property owned or leased by Montgomery County. The ban would include all County properties except public rights of way. Councilmember Nancy Floreen is the chief sponsor of the bill. The Council’s […]

County Council Meets on Jan. 15
The Montgomery County Council on Tuesday, Jan. 15, will introduce a resolution that offers its support of state and federal legislation regulating the sale of guns and ammunition. The Council is scheduled to take action on the resolution on Jan. 22. The Council’s regular session will begin at 9:30 a.m. in the Third Floor Council […]
